About this listen

Diamond Pearl Hope is a biracial news reporter. She experiences a hard childhood. Diamond is only 10 years old when her black mother dies. She goes to live with relatives who discriminate against her because she is mixed-race. Diamond is rescued from abusive family members through adoption. While growing up, she is kept in the dark about her white father. After graduating from college she meets and marries an older abusive man. Diamond gets arrested for assaulting her husband, and comes face-to-face with the man she thought she'd never meet. Diamond's life story comes to a wonderful ending when her white and black relatives unite in love, as one big happy blended family.
